Web19 aug. 2024 · Watering with a nice shower setting on your hose is a good way to go with your hydrangeas. This will provide gentle watering that will be able to be absorbed by the soil. If you water with too much pressure, the water will likely just run off. If you are able to use a soaker hose or drip irrigation, that would be ideal. Web10 apr. 2024 · To maintain moisture, cover your hydrangea cutting a clear plastic bag. Keep in a spot that gets bright, indirect sunlight, and make sure to water regularly. You can transplant the cutting in the garden after it has rooted. To check if it has rooted, gently tug the stem and if it stays in place, it's ready for planting.

WebWatering Frequency for Hydrangeas. Hydrangeas are beautiful and delicate plants that require consistent moisture to thrive. It is recommended to water hydrangeas at a rate of 1 inch per week throughout the growing season. However, to encourage root growth, it is best to deeply water the plants 3 times a week. Web5 apr. 2024 · Water 1-2 times a week, about one inch of water. ‘Annabelle’ should be planted in well-draining soil that can retain some moisture. Some parts of the year they may be happy with the amount of rainfall they get. Other times, you may need to water a few times a week. The goal here is about one inch of water per week.
